Exercise 3.2 Roots of Quadratic Equations Write a program to check the number of distinct real roots of a quadratic equation given its coefficients. Suppose the quadratic equation is ax2 + bx + c = 0. The inputs to your program will be a, b, and c in order. Your program should then print the number of the distinct real roots of the equation. You can assume that input a, b, and c are integers, and a will never be 0. Hints: the number of distinct real roots of a quadratic equation can be determined by its discriminant b2 - 4ac.
